In the course of Chris Isaak’s career, he has released ten extraordinary albums, including the critically acclaimed new album First Comes The Night, twelve singles, been nominated for two Grammy awards, acted in several motion pictures and starred in his own critically acclaimed TV series. His haunting voice, fierce guitar, glittered outfits and legendary shows with his stellar bandmates Silvertone have entertained tens of thousands of people for over two decades.
It is hard to classify Isaak with one genre of music since he displays many different musical personas: the rockabilly rebel (“Dancin’,” “Baby Did A Bad, Bad Thing,” “Speak Of The Devil”), the brokenhearted crooner (“Wicked Game,” “Somebody’s Crying”), and the breezy acoustic storyteller (“San Francisco Days,” “Two Hearts”).
First Comes the Night on Vanguard Records is Isaak’s first recording of original songs in six years. It was recorded in Nashville and Los Angeles and produced by Dave Cobb (Chris Stapleton, Jason Isbell), Paul Worley (Dixie Chicks, Lady Antebellum), and longtime collaborator Mark Needham. First Comes the Night is the follow up to Isaak’s 2011 Beyond The Sun masterpiece CD - a breathtaking tribute album to Sun Records, Sam Phillips and the visionary artists who continue to inspire him and helped shape the early sounds of rock ‘n’ roll.
Knowns as a supreme showman and one of the funniest live performers today, Isaak is a non-stop touring Grammy nominated singer-songwriter, actor and talk show host. He has appeared on many TV shows and has acted in several films and starred in Showtime’s The Chris Isaak Show and the Chris Isaak Hour on the Biography Channel. He was a recent judge on the X-Factor in Australia, performed at the opening of the Super Bowl festivities in San Francisco and was recently profiled on CBS Sunday Morning.
